Disappointing day at Bruntingthorpe
Took my GT there did our first run tyres and brakes were stone cold.
Wanted to do a few warm up runs first
Destroyed the car next to me got to 160 then eased off didn't fancy braking at 200 MPH on cold brakes.
The GT was unbelievably quick with the Whipple 4LTR and FR Headers
Come back in to do a second run Marshall comes over and said the owner of the track who lives nearby had rang to say whoever that car was it is to loud and I was barred from going back and doing any more runs.
It's an airfield for planes haha you couldn't write it.

How pathetic.

To be honest it's like the Wild West there full of journeyman and not very safe there was a bad accident
Supra rolled over several times and Air Ambulance Attended.
Hoping they are ok.
Won't be going back.
